WOW - a question dear to my heart rod_s.

We too did the same intensive search you did looking at beaucoup makes/models. After literally a 12 month search (we liked what we had and weren't in a hurry) we almost decided upon the Big Horn 3585RL ... it was a close ... but then we saw a 3685RL this past May and fell in love with the idea of the power up/down TV (which we never watch anyway during the day) and that large open window effect. We ordered it in early June. Literally, on the assembly line our dealer called to say his factory rep said there will be some changes in the new 2014's. The wood will change to Chestnut (no idea what that's going to look like now), the windows will be changed to match the frameless windows of the Landmark (sweet, we LOVED that upgrade), and the window shades will be changed getting rid of the day/nite shades and replacing with the newer roller shades the Landmark has (sweet, we Love that upgrade and no additional charge to us, as new orders are a "forced" $1100 option.)

So far we are greatly pleased - small changes are always going to happen and these were for the better to us - and we assume we'll like the new chestnut color tones of the wood. Well - the new coach arrives at our dealer and they are shocked as they know we wanted the floorplan we saw and ordered ... and they were not told of a major change like that. They sent us a picture of it .... and we were heartbroken and so upset we didn't sleep that nite. Well - I can tell you - it has been 2 months (we haven't taken a maiden voyage in it yet...Florida bound in 2 months) - but time has healed the wounds and disappointment. All that said - it is a beautiful coach. We ordered it with EVERY option except the generator. The partial paint version is incredible, the frameless windows are awesome ... you'll love the roller shades ... and we are delighted that they also upgraded the kitchen counter to include matching stove covers like the Landmarks had.

I have already experienced incredible personal service from the Big Horn / Landmark General Manager ... who by the way apologized that the ball got dropped in communicating the TV / window floorplan change out to my dealer. My brother in law and sister have a Mobile Suites with the power up / down window ... and say they end up leaving the TV up most of the time or that window shade drawn as you only looking at the front of your neighbors rig anyway. If you need another advantage, your TV now goes from a 42" to a 46".

There are so many things right about this coach (and by the way, if you can swing it, I would definitely add the 6 point leveling system) and the Heartland customer service is awesome, I think you will be happy with it. Got our 3685RL in May and we full-time and so far love it. We too were a little disappointed in the window not being behind the tv, but have gotten used to it. We have made a couple suggestions today that would help our situation a little and one that would probably help everyone. We found the bedroom closet doors to be just a little too close to the rail and this won't let the doors slide by without hitting clothing on a hanger. Otherwise, love it, especially the couch in the back.
